What Causes Acid Reflux Cough?
The mechanism behind acid reflux cough involves the lower esophageal sphincter (LES), a muscular valve that normally prevents stomach contents from flowing backward into the esophagus. When this sphincter weakens or relaxes inappropriately, stomach acid can escape upward, reaching the throat and larynx area.
This acidic exposure triggers protective reflexes in the respiratory system, leading to persistent coughing as the body attempts to clear the irritating substance. The vagus nerve, which connects the esophagus to the brain, can also become stimulated by acid exposure, creating a neurological pathway that promotes coughing even when acid levels are minimal.
Several factors can contribute to the development of acid reflux cough, including obesity, pregnancy, certain medications, smoking, and dietary triggers such as spicy foods, citrus fruits, chocolate, and caffeine.
Recognizing the Signs and Symptoms
Acid reflux cough presents with distinctive characteristics that differentiate it from other types of coughs. The cough is typically dry and non-productive, meaning it doesn't bring up phlegm or mucus. It often worsens when lying down, particularly at night, and may be accompanied by a sour or bitter taste in the mouth.
Many people experience throat clearing, hoarseness, and a sensation of something stuck in the throat, medically known as globus sensation. The cough may be more pronounced after meals, especially large or trigger-containing foods, and can persist for hours or even days after acid exposure.
Interestingly, some individuals with acid reflux cough may not experience the classic heartburn symptoms typically associated with GERD, a condition known as silent reflux or laryngopharyngeal reflux (LPR).
Treatment Approaches and Timeline
Effective treatment of acid reflux cough typically involves a multi-faceted approach targeting both the underlying acid reflux and the resulting respiratory symptoms. Proton pump inhibitors (PPIs) such as omeprazole, lansoprazole, and esomeprazole are often the first-line treatment, working to reduce stomach acid production significantly.
H2 receptor blockers like ranitidine and famotidine can also provide relief by decreasing acid production, though they are generally less potent than PPIs. Antacids offer quick but temporary relief by neutralizing existing stomach acid.
The timeline for improvement varies considerably among individuals. Some people notice relief within days of starting treatment, while others may require several weeks or even months of consistent therapy. Complete resolution of acid reflux cough often takes longer than heartburn symptoms to disappear, as the respiratory tissues may need additional time to heal from chronic irritation.
Lifestyle Modifications for Long-Term Relief
Implementing strategic lifestyle changes forms the cornerstone of managing acid reflux cough effectively. Elevating the head of the bed by 6-8 inches using blocks or a wedge pillow can help prevent nighttime acid reflux by utilizing gravity to keep stomach contents in place.
Dietary modifications play a crucial role in symptom management. Avoiding common trigger foods such as citrus fruits, tomatoes, chocolate, mint, spicy foods, and fatty meals can significantly reduce acid production and reflux episodes. Eating smaller, more frequent meals instead of large portions helps prevent excessive stomach distension and pressure on the LES.
Weight management is particularly important, as excess abdominal weight increases pressure on the stomach and promotes acid reflux. Smoking cessation is essential, as tobacco use weakens the LES and increases acid production. Avoiding eating within three hours of bedtime allows adequate time for stomach emptying before lying down.
When Silent Reflux Occurs
Silent reflux, or laryngopharyngeal reflux (LPR), represents a unique form of acid reflux where stomach acid reaches the throat and larynx without causing typical heartburn symptoms. This condition can cause chronic cough as the primary or only symptom, making diagnosis challenging.
The absence of heartburn occurs because the esophagus may be less sensitive to acid exposure, or the acid may not remain in contact with esophageal tissues long enough to cause burning sensations. However, the throat and larynx tissues are much more sensitive to acid, leading to inflammation and cough responses even with minimal exposure.
Healthcare providers often use specialized tests such as pH monitoring or laryngoscopy to diagnose silent reflux when chronic cough persists without other obvious causes.
Prevention Strategies
Preventing acid reflux cough involves adopting long-term habits that support healthy digestive function and reduce the likelihood of acid reflux episodes. Maintaining a healthy weight through balanced nutrition and regular exercise helps reduce abdominal pressure on the stomach.
Stress management techniques such as meditation, yoga, or deep breathing exercises can be beneficial, as stress can increase stomach acid production and worsen reflux symptoms. Staying adequately hydrated with water throughout the day helps dilute stomach acid and supports proper digestion.
Regular meal timing and avoiding rushing through meals can improve digestive efficiency and reduce the likelihood of reflux episodes that trigger coughing.
